Quicksand runs the nightly search reindex for Marrowbank at 02:00 UTC. It drains the old index, rebuilds from the catalog snapshot, then swaps aliases. Failures page the search rotation, not the app team. The indexer authenticates to the cluster with a credential read from its env file on startup; the required line goes directly below.

vault entry, yahif-yajep: COURIER_KEY29=b802bdf8034096b65a51c6ba5abe2

Flagpath is the rollout framework behind all staged feature releases at Quillmere. It handles percentage ramps, cohort targeting, and automatic rollback on error-budget burn. Reviewers: changes to `ramp/engine` require two approvals and a dry-run report; config-only changes need one. Never merge anything touching the kill-switch path without a rollback test attached. Flag definitions live in `registry/` and are validated in CI — do not hand-edit generated files. Final merge authority for protected paths rests with the maintainer named below.

account owner for bawip-tahag: Raleth Quenok

## Relevance Tuning Notes

The Findwell ranking weights live in the `tuning/` directory and were last recalibrated after the autumn relevance review. Each change must be backed by an offline judgment set run; never adjust boost factors directly in production config. Historical rationale for every weight is recorded in the tuning changelog, and reading it before any modification is mandatory. Questions about past decisions or judgment-set methodology should go to the address below.

escalation mailbox, hadug-bajog: sormir@norvalabs.internal